Welcome to King County, Washington, a vibrant and diverse region that seamlessly blends urban sophistication with breathtaking natural beauty. Nestled in the heart of the Pacific Northwest, King County is home to Seattle, the Emerald City, renowned for its iconic Space Needle, thriving tech scene, and rich cultural heritage. With a population of over 2 million residents, it stands as the most populous county in Washington State, offering a dynamic mix of bustling city life and serene suburban neighborhoods.

King County boasts a plethora of outdoor recreational opportunities, thanks to its stunning landscapes that include lush forests, majestic mountains, and picturesque waterfronts. The nearby Cascade Range invites adventure enthusiasts for hiking, skiing, and mountain biking, while the shores of Lake Washington and Puget Sound provide ample opportunities for boating, fishing, and kayaking.

The county is also celebrated for its exceptional educational institutions, including the University of Washington, which attracts students and researchers from around the globe. Families will appreciate the strong sense of community, top-rated schools, and diverse cultural experiences available in neighborhoods like Ballard, Capitol Hill, and West Seattle.

With a robust economy fueled by major industries such as technology, healthcare, and aerospace, King County is an attractive destination for professionals and entrepreneurs alike. The vibrant arts scene, delicious culinary offerings, and a calendar full of events ensure there’s always something happening.
